References:
Once you have viewed a property, we request for an application form to be completed which then gets submitted to the landlord. If the application has been accepted, we request a reservation payment, which is the equivalent to one week’s rent, which allows us to take the property off the market and is then deducted from the first month’s rent following satisfactory references. We carry out a full credit check and request employer, character, and landlord references where required. Each tenant will need to bring in their passport in person to our office and provide share codes for the right to rent checks if applicable.
Tenancy agreement and obligations:
Tenancy agreements outline the obligations of both the landlord and tenant, and we offer a minimum tenancy period of six or twelve months. After this initial period, it may be possible to negotiate a tenancy renewal with the landlord. We carry out regular property inspections, usually every 6 months, and we hold keys at our office for all managed properties. We will always provide 24 hours’ notice prior to viewings and inspections, and our contractors will call you directly to discuss access for maintenance issues.
Although the landlord has several obligations to ensure the safety of the property, the responsibility for the day-to-day maintenance of the property lies with the tenants. This includes cleaning the property, ventilating and sufficiently heating the property, and reporting any maintenance issues to the managing agent. Unless otherwise stated, bills are also the tenant’s responsibility to pay, and we will provide you with opening meter readings and notify utility suppliers and the council at the start of the tenancy.
Rent payments and additional fees:
For managed properties Nicholas George Ltd will collect the first month’s rent and full deposit prior to your move in. Then going forward, all future rent payments must be made in advance to us by standing order and we will provide you with our bank details before you move in. For let only properties Nicholas George Ltd will collect the first month’s rent and full deposit prior to your move in. Then going forward, all future rent payments must be paid to the landlord directly and we will provide you with the landlord’s bank details on the tenancy start date.
Letting agents are no longer able to charge administration fees at the start of the tenancy, however some other fees may be applicable, such as call-out charges for maintenance issues caused by tenant misuse and for tenancy add-ons, or for ending a tenancy early. Please note requests for a tenancy add-on and for ending a tenancy early are at the discretion of the landlord and for the latter are for exceptional circumstances only.
